Thanks tamouse and Matma. In the end I cheated. While certainly not =
pretty, or efficient , I opted for a two-pass read. First time through I =
look for a match of the "insFld(foldersTree, gFld", then I simply added =
### to the beginning of the line and replaced that in my array. During =
the next read I simply split on the three hash symbols. It's so much =
easier to split knowing what is at the beginning of a section, than text =
in the middle. ;)=20

Thanks again to both of you.=20

Wayne